Transaction 66c02f251f4f461d7691de1caa4e98ea19f5b6bca76897c0012433dac91742b7
1 Input
1 Output
-
66c02f251f4f461d7691de1caa4e98ea19f5b6bca76897c0012433dac91742b7:0
- value
- 3523
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6892f76d77808454cd524d6b4fff0c6416acc696 OP_EQUAL
- address
- 3BDxFuXqJ5WJLzEUx49YaqvQXFBazR6NnX